    Also, I put this in the blog story, but one more thing to remember: if Parsons is the golden ticket for this trade, it has to happen by June 30. That way, Minnesota could decline his option, send him to restricted free agency and match any offer.

    Once June 30 passes and Parsons is officially bound for unrestricted free agency in 2015, he'd be in the exact same contractual position as Love, and Minnesota would have no incentive to do the trade since Parsons could (and would) exit after one year, just like Love.
